China Evergrande NewEnergy Vehicle Group, the car making arm of China's biggest property developer China Evergrande, today unveiled its first batch of six vehicles in Shanghai and Guangzhou at the same time.

They are the Hengchi 1, Hengchi 2, Hengchi 3, Hengchi 4, Hengchi 5 and Hengchi 6, covering all classes from A to D, as well as passenger vehicles such as sedans, coupes, SUVs, MPVs and crossovers.

Since announcing its entry into the automotive sector, China Evergrande has launched its automotive products in just two years.

Previously named Evergrande Health, the company announced last week that it intends to change the company's name to "China Evergrande NewEnergy Vehicle Group Limited" in light of the fact that new energy vehicles have become the group's most important business.

The company said it already has the world's top core technologies in each key segment and has collaborative research and development centers in China, Sweden, Germany, the UK, the Netherlands, Austria, Italy, Japan and South Korea.

It aims to become the world's largest and strongest new energy vehicle group in 3-5 years, the company said.
